I have eaten here many times but it always seems the same downstairs - busy, no seats and mediocre service. However, if you choose to eat upstairs it is quite different - helpful staff, good menu and no rushing. The toilets are not convenient from downstairs either - they are located up lots of stairs. Overall, avoid the lower level and eat upstairs in the restaurant.

This cafe has been in Galway for years, and other than redecorating it has never improved. The staff can be very abrupt; the prices are extremely high for Galway, normally its impossible to get a seat. I normally just go in for a quick coffee when meeting someone in Galway, outside the GBC is a common meeting place!
